Access GPT-4o, Claude, and Gemini for writing, ideation, and content generation. monday AI focuses on automations and status updates, not deep content creation.
Record meetings and turn conversations into documents and action items automatically. monday.com has no audio or transcription capabilities.
Turn any document into a live, branded webpage with one click. monday Docs are internal — no way to publish content to the outside world.
Inktrail's canvas is built for diagrams, architecture planning, and visual thinking. monday Whiteboard is a basic add-on, not a core creative tool.

For document creation, visual planning, AI content generation, and publishing — yes. For project management with boards, Gantt charts, automations, and CRM — no. Inktrail focuses on creating deliverables, while monday.com focuses on managing workflows.
Inktrail organizes work in project workspaces with documents, canvases, and assets. It uses AI to help manage workflows, but doesn't have monday.com's board-based task tracking, timeline views, or resource management.
monday Docs are designed to live alongside boards and items. Inktrail's editor is purpose-built for content creation with multi-model AI, canvas integration, audio transcription, and one-click publishing that monday Docs lack.
Yes. Many teams use monday.com for project tracking and workflow management, and Inktrail for content creation, visual planning, meeting notes, and publishing. The two tools handle different parts of the workflow.
Inktrail's free tier includes documents, canvas, AI credits, and publishing. monday.com's free tier is limited to 2 seats. monday AI requires their Pro plan or higher. Inktrail includes multi-model AI natively in all plans.
